Fiji Weather Warning: Strong Winds and Heavy Rain Across Lau, Lomaiviti, Kadavu, Taveuni and Eastern Viti Levu

Hold onto your hats, folks! The weather is getting a bit tumultuous this weekend, with strong wind warnings blowing through Lau and Lomaiviti groups, Kadavu, and Taveuni. So, if you’ve ever dreamed of trying out your windsurfing skills on dry land, now’s your chance! Just kidding—stay indoors!

The eastern half of Viti Levu is also under a heavy rain alert. Yes, that’s right—after enduring an ongoing moist southeasterly wind flow, it seems we’re going to need arc-building skills for the rain showers expected over Serua-Namosi, Navua-Suva-Nausori, Tailevu-Naitasiri-Ra, Southern Bua, Cakaudrove, Taveuni, and those charming little islands nearby. Expect the clouds to do some heavy lifting today, moving from mild showers to occasional downpours that might just need their own umbrella!

And for those hoping for a sunny break, you may just find a few isolated thunderstorms creating surprise party vibes elsewhere. So, you might want to wear a raincoat with your shorts—you’ll definitely be the fashion icon of uncertain weather!

As for the wind, it’s expected to be a wild ride with southeasterly gusts reaching up to 45 km/h in the aforementioned areas. And let’s not forget, rough seas could mean that mermaid adventures might just stay on hold for now.

Looking ahead towards Sunday, be prepared for a mix of occasional rain and thunder (we’re talking about the dramatic kind), especially over our favorite regions. Elsewhere could see some partly cloudy charm turning into afternoon or evening thunderstorms. Remember: localised heavy rainfall might lead to some flash floods, so be careful not to turn your backyard into a wading pool!

Now let’s break down a few specific areas:

For Navua/Suva/Nausori, expect cloudy periods with some showers and the possibility of a few raging thunderstorms. Tomorrow’s temperatures will be a comfy 24°C to a steamy 30°C, making it a classic flip-flop and umbrella day!

Over at Sigatoka/Coral Coast, you may bask in fine weather – but just when you’re about to leave the house, those sneaky afternoon showers and thunderstorms will make their entrance. Hot tip: Bring an umbrella!

As for our friends in Nadi/Lautoka/Ba, expect relatively sunny vibes, followed by some uninvited thunderstorms and heavy showers. Models suggest a cozy temperature range between 22°C and a balmy 33°C.

Tavua/Rakiraki is also prepping for some action with cloudy weather and isolated thunderstorms lurking about. Tomorrow’s going to range from 23°C to 32°C—perfect for a quick dash to the shop between rain showers.

In Taveuni, get ready for a cloudy, rainy day with the wind showing off its might at up to 45 km/h. Just the right conditions to practice your “whoops-I-just-spilled-my-drink” face.
